Product Description
Using the Clover Pom Pom Maker and yarns, ribbons, or fibers you can create a wide variety of decorative pom poms to embellish wearables,home decor items, a$nd accessories of all kinds. Ingenious tool design produces perfect pom poms every time. Two sizes - approx. 1-3/8 inch & 1-5/8 inch. Ideal for embellishments and perfect for scarves, bags, sweaters and more.

Up until I got these handy gadgets, I had generally avoided making pom-poms. Now that I have these, I'm back in love with pom-poms.

Using cardboard as my base was tricky, because the cardboard sometimes bent if it wasn't stiff enough or it would snag the yarn as I tried to remove the yarn from the cardboard.

I've also used the Lion Brand donut-shaped pom-pom makers, which work well, but looping the yarn through the center of the makers can be tedious, because you can't do it in one fluid wrapping motion as you can using a cardboard "maker".

So along comes the Clover pom-pom makers using the best of both worlds....1) fluid wrapping of yarn and 2) ease of removing the pom-pom. Not only that, it has a way of indicating when you have wrapped enough yarn...you simply fill up the C-shaped "arms". No more wimpy-looking pom-poms.

The Clover makers work similarly to the donut-shaped makers, in that two pieces are held and wrapped together with yarn, then the yarn is cut between the pieces and pulled apart. But the Clover gadgets differ from the donut-shaped makers in that there are two "half donuts" (or arms) to wrap. The two halves are snapped closed before cutting the yarn to form the finished pom-pom. Sounds strange, but it works really well.

I highly recommend checking out Cloverneedlecraft's "how to" video on Yahoo. Also I recommend use of small sharp scissors for cutting the pom-pom yarn.

I have bought both the Large set and the Small set of makers, which gives me four different sizes to play with. Back in love with pom-poms.
